KinderSystems Acquires COPA

On October 26, 2021, KinderSystems acquired software company COPA

Target Company

COPA

Tarzana, California, United States
COPA provides web-based data management software solutions for Early Childhood Education programs and community services. COPA's solution is used by Head Start, Family Child Care, Early Head Start, State Funded Pre-K, locally designed and Community Action Programs across the nation to track, manage and monitor data, and report outcomes. COPA was founded in 2001 and is based in Tarzana, California.

DESCRIPTION

KinderSystems is a provider of childcare subsidy management software to state governments and local childcare agencies. KinderSystems enable social service agencies and childcare providers to manage cases more efficiently, reduce clerical errors, remove worker frustration, and reduce fraud. KinderSystems was founded in 1993 and is based in Escondido, California.
